Missing Alzheimer’s Disease Patient Alert Program Reauthorization Act of 2015
A BILL
To amend the Violent Crime Control and Law Enforcement Act of 1994 to reauthorize the Missing Alzheimer’s Disease Patient Alert Program.
Sec. 2 Reauthorization of the Missing Alzheimer’s Disease Patient Alert Program
“(a) Grant—Subject to the availability of appropriations to carry out this section, the Attorney General, through the Bureau of Justice Assistance and in consultation with the Secretary of Health and Human Services, shall award competitive grants to nonprofit organizations to assist such organizations in paying for the costs of planning, designing, establishing, and operating locally based, proactive programs to protect and locate missing patients with Alzheimer’s disease and related dementias.”
“(c) Preference—In awarding grants under subsection (a), the Attorney General shall give preference to national nonprofit organizations that have experience working with patients, and families of patients, with Alzheimer’s disease and related dementias.”
“(d) Authorization of appropriations—There are authorized to be appropriated to carry out this section $5,000,000 for each of the fiscal years 2016 through 2020.”
